Embodiment Construction

[0032] Such as figure 1 , figure 2 Among them, a robot used for automatic deicing of high-voltage transmission lines, three groups of rotating mechanisms 1 are installed on the base 7 in the shape of "pin" to rotate the components installed on it at a certain angle; so that the components on it can be rotated by one After an angle of 180°, for example, avoid obstacles above the high-voltage transmission line to achieve obstacle surmounting. And this structure can also avoid that the center of gravity of the present invention in work deviates to one side.

[0033] Such as image 3 Among them, the rotating mechanism 1 in the middle is located on one side of the base 7, on which an auxiliary hanging mechanism 3 that can be hung on the high-voltage transmission line is installed;

Abstract

Provided is a robot used for automatically deicing a high tension transmission line. A support is provided with three sets of rotary mechanisms making the members arranged on the support rotate for a certain angle in a manner of a Chinese character pin. The middle rotary mechanism is located at one side of the support and is provided with an auxiliary hang mechanism which can be hung to the high tension power line. The rotary mechanisms on both ends are located on the other side of the support and are provided with elevating systems which can make the members provided on the rotary mechanismselevate. The elevating systems are provided with a deicing mechanism and a running gear driving the robot to walk on the high tension power line. According to the structure provided in the invention,the robot can stably creep on the overhead high tension power line at a preset speed, the auxiliary hang mechanism and running gear arranged in the manner of the Chinese character pin prevent the robot from falling in scurvy weathers, and the cooperation of the rotary mechanisms and elevating systems can help the robot conveniently step over the barriers such as stockbridge dampers, wire clamps, insulators and the like on the high tension power line.

Description

technical field [0001] The invention relates to a deicing device for a high-voltage transmission line, in particular to a robot for automatic deicing of a high-voltage transmission line. Background technique [0002] With the rapid development of my country's economy, more and more ultra-high-voltage large-capacity transmission lines are built, and the geographical environment that the line corridor passes through is more complicated, such as passing through large-scale reservoirs, lakes and mountains, which brings many difficulties to line maintenance. There are about 270,000 kilometers of 500Vk ultra-high voltage transmission lines in my country. In order to ensure their safe and reliable operation, regular inspection and maintenance are very necessary.
